如何管理应用后台更新频率?

在当今快速发展的互联网时代,应用后台更新频率的管理显得尤为重要。这不仅关系到用户体验,还直接影响到应用的稳定性和竞争力。那么,如何有效地管理应用后台更新频率呢?本文将从以下几个方面进行探讨。

一、了解应用后台更新频率的重要性

1. 提升用户体验

应用后台更新频率的合理控制,可以确保用户在使用过程中,享受到流畅、稳定的体验。频繁的更新可能导致应用崩溃、数据丢失等问题,从而影响用户体验。因此,合理控制更新频率,确保应用稳定运行,是提升用户体验的关键。

2. 保障应用安全

应用后台更新频率的管理,有助于及时发现并修复安全漏洞。随着黑客攻击手段的不断升级,应用安全风险日益增加。通过定期更新,可以修复已知的安全漏洞,降低应用被攻击的风险。

3. 提高应用竞争力

在竞争激烈的应用市场中,应用后台更新频率的管理是提高竞争力的关键。通过不断优化功能、修复bug,可以吸引用户,提高用户粘性,从而在市场中脱颖而出。

二、如何管理应用后台更新频率

1. 制定合理的更新计划

(1)需求分析

在制定更新计划之前,首先要对应用的需求进行分析。了解用户需求、市场趋势以及竞争对手的动态,有助于制定出符合实际需求的更新计划。

(2)版本迭代

根据需求分析,将更新内容划分为多个版本,逐步进行迭代。每个版本都要有明确的更新目标,确保更新内容的实用性和可维护性。

2. 优化更新流程

(1)版本控制

采用版本控制系统,如Git,对代码进行版本管理。这有助于跟踪代码变更、快速回滚、协同开发等。

(2)自动化测试

在更新过程中,进行自动化测试,确保更新后的应用稳定运行。测试内容包括功能测试、性能测试、安全测试等。

3. 提高更新效率

(1)并行开发

采用并行开发模式,同时进行多个版本的更新工作。这有助于缩短开发周期,提高更新效率。

(2)持续集成

引入持续集成(CI)工具,实现自动化构建、测试和部署。这有助于确保更新过程的高效、稳定。

三、案例分析

以某知名社交应用为例,该应用在更新频率管理方面做得较为出色。以下是该应用的几个特点:

1. 定期发布更新

该应用每月至少发布一次更新,确保用户在使用过程中,能够享受到最新的功能和服务。

2. 版本迭代清晰

更新内容划分为多个版本,每个版本都有明确的更新目标。这使得用户能够清晰地了解应用的发展方向。

3. 自动化测试

在更新过程中,进行自动化测试,确保更新后的应用稳定运行。

4. 持续集成

引入持续集成工具,实现自动化构建、测试和部署,提高更新效率。

通过以上措施,该应用在更新频率管理方面取得了显著成效,用户满意度不断提高。

总结

应用后台更新频率的管理是提升用户体验、保障应用安全、提高应用竞争力的关键。通过制定合理的更新计划、优化更新流程、提高更新效率等措施,可以有效管理应用后台更新频率。希望本文能为您提供一定的参考价值。

猜你喜欢:云网监控平台